Metal cladding repair services involve restoring and maintaining the protective outer layer of a building’s exterior made from metal panels or sheets. These services typically address issues such as corrosion, dents, warping, or damage caused by weather or impact. Skilled technicians assess the extent of the damage, remove compromised sections if necessary, and replace or repair the affected panels to restore the building’s appearance and structural integrity. Proper repair work ensures that the metal cladding continues to serve its purpose of protecting the underlying structure from environmental elements.
This service helps resolve common problems associated with aging or damaged metal cladding, including leaks, rust, and aesthetic deterioration. Over time, exposure to moisture, wind, and debris can weaken the metal, leading to corrosion or holes that compromise insulation and energy efficiency. Repairing these issues promptly can prevent further deterioration, reduce the risk of water infiltration, and extend the lifespan of the cladding system. Professionals also address issues like loose panels or fasteners, which can pose safety concerns if left unattended.

Material Replacement Costs - Replacing damaged metal panels typically ranges from $1,000 to $4,000 depending on panel size and type. For example, a standard section may cost around $2,000. Costs vary based on material choice and extent of damage.
Labor Expenses - Labor for metal cladding repairs generally falls between $50 and $150 per hour. Complete repairs for small sections might total $500 to $1,500, while larger projects can reach $5,000 or more. Rates depend on project complexity and local contractor rates.
Surface Preparation and Painting - Surface prep and painting services can add $300 to $1,200 to repair costs. This includes cleaning, sanding, and applying protective coatings to extend the lifespan of the cladding. The final price depends on the surface area and condition.
Additional Repair Costs - Unexpected issues such as rust removal or structural reinforcement may increase costs by $200 to $1,000. These expenses vary based on the severity of underlying problems and required repairs. Local pros can provide detailed estimates after assessment.

What types of metal cladding can be repaired? Local service providers can typically repair various types of metal cladding including aluminum, steel, and copper, addressing issues like dents, corrosion, or damaged panels.
How do repair services address corrosion or rust? Professionals often remove rusted areas, treat them with protective coatings, and replace severely damaged sections to restore integrity.
What are common signs that metal cladding needs repair? Visible dents, corrosion, warping, or loose panels are indicators that repair services may be necessary.
Can metal cladding be repaired without full replacement? Yes, many repairs involve patching or panel replacement, allowing for restoration without complete removal of the cladding.
How do repair services ensure the longevity of metal cladding? Local pros typically clean, treat, and seal the surface during repairs to help extend the lifespan of the cladding.
